City and County to Host Area 1B Community Forum March 19

The City and County of Santa Fe will host a community forum on the future of Area 1B on Thursday, March 19, from 6:00-7:30 p.m. at the Food Depot, 1222 Siler Rd., Suite A, Santa Fe, NM 87507.


Area 1B is located on the west side of Santa Fe near Agua FrĂ­a and has been the subject of ongoing discussions regarding potential jurisdiction, planning, and service options.

Earlier this year, the City and County convened a working group comprised of County Commissioners Lisa Cacari Stone and Adam F. Johnson and City Councilors Alma Castro and Pat Feghali to explore options related to Area 1B, including possible annexation and alternatives.

"The discussions around Area 1B build on many years of community dialogue and resident input," Commissioner Cacari Stone said in a statement. "We take that history seriously as we work together across City and County governments to ensure community priorities help guide the policy decisions ahead."

The working group is tasked with assessing a range of considerations, including land use, infrastructure, service delivery, and community priorities. To date, the group has met twice, including a "Living Lands" tour of the area, and City and County staff have conducted preliminary analyses of potential options.

Councilor Castro added, "The working group wants to help create a path forward through trust and mutual respect. We aim to facilitate compromise in which we preserve tradition and promote thoughtful development for future generations."

The March 19 forum will provide residents and community members with an opportunity to learn about the options being considered, ask questions, and share feedback. Public input will help inform the ongoing evaluation process.

No final determination regarding annexation or other options will be made until community feedback has been meaningfully incorporated.

Residents may attend in person or participate remotely. Remote participation information will be provided to those who register in advance.
